You should try to find a shop that has the capability to balance trailer tires. It is suggested to lug-centric balance them instead of the normal way using the center hole of the wheel, hub-centric balancing. Because the wheels on most trailers use the lug studs to place the wheel in position on the hub, instead of a machined and perfectly centered hole that fits snugly onto a machined hub, the hole in the wheel most times is not centered properly. With a proper attachment for the balancing machine that supports the wheel by the lug holes, you will get a good balance job.
